| Since the 18 th National Congress of the CPC,the Chinese government has paid more attention to the construction of ecological civilization,and green development has been added to the new development concept.With the growing awareness of ecology and environmental protection in the whole society,more and more consumers have started to admire the concept of green consumption.In the face of the national strategy of "green development" and the consumer demand for "high quality,green" agricultural products,the adoption of a green and sustainable development model is an inevitable choice for the long-term development of agriculture.Economical and efficient green farming techniques are essential for the advancement of green agriculture.In the process of agricultural transformation and upgrading,the green technology adoption behaviour of family farms,as an important part of new agricultural business entities,is crucial to the green development of agriculture as a whole.Therefore,taking family farms as the object of study and exploring their application of green technologies will help the proliferation of green technologies and contribute to the promotion of green agricultural development.Against this background,this paper combs through the relevant literature and focuses on the impact of technology cognition on the adoption behaviour of green technologies on family farms,based on theories of farmer behaviour,planned behaviour and technology diffusion,with technology cognition as the entry point.Based on the theoretical analysis,a binary logit model was constructed using research data from 283 family farms in Chongqing through the statistical software Stata 16 to empirically analyse the relationship between technology perception,farm owner characteristics,basic farm characteristics,business characteristics,environmental characteristics and green technology adoption,and then heterogeneity analysis and robustness tests were used to enrich and verify the scientific validity and reasonableness of the research results.The specific findings of this paper are:(1)Adoption rate of green technologies among the family farms in the sample is about 78%,indicating that most family farms attach more importance to green development in agriculture and participate in it with practical actions,but there are still a small number of family farms whose attitude towards green development still needs to be strengthened.(2)The empirical analysis shows that among the variables related to technology perception,the perceived level of economic benefits,ecological benefits,social benefits and perceived ease of use have a significant positive effect on the green technology adoption behaviour of family farms,while the risk perception of technology does not pass the significance test.(3)Among the control variables,age in farm owner characteristics has a significant inhibiting effect on their technology adoption behaviour.The number of labourers in the basic characteristics of family farms had a significant negative effect on technology adoption,while membership of cooperatives and participation in agricultural insurance had a significant positive effect on technology adoption.Whether or not to join a cooperative among the basic characteristics of family farms has a significant positive effect on technology adoption.Whether or not to participate in e-commerce has a significant positive impact on family farm green technology adoption behavior.(4)There are differences in the effects of technology perceptions on green technology adoption behaviour between participating and non-participating family farms.Based on the above findings,this paper proposes the following suggestions on how to promote the green technology adoption behaviour of family farms:(1)The level of awareness of the benefits of green technology should be raised and the operability of green technology enhanced.Promote the economic,social and ecological benefits of green technologies through various platforms,reduce the difficulty of the technologies during the development phase and enhance their operability through training.(2)Improve the guarantee mechanism for the adoption of green technologies by family farms,such as providing technical support for the promotion of green technologies through cooperatives;and establishing a risk transfer mechanism for the adoption of green technologies by farms through the agricultural insurance system.(3)Build a diversified e-commerce trading platform,open up the packaging and transportation circulation links for e-commerce sales,ensure that the quality of agricultural products sold by e-commerce is not compromised,and attract more agricultural products suitable for online sales to join the ranks of e-commerce.(4)Distinguish between the differences and use different extension strategies based on the different characteristics of the family farm.. |
